The Church and its Influence: Nurturing Christian Education

by OLUWASEUN. M. ADESINA

Introduction:

As I reflect on the significance of Christian education, my thoughts turn to the woman who played a pivotal role in my spiritual growth, instilling in me the importance of resisting temptation. This article aims to appraise the church’s role in Christian education, drawing inspiration from biblical passages and personal experiences.


The Early Foundation:

From a young age, I recognized the importance of nurturing children’s faith, guided by the words of Jesus, “Let the little children come to me, and do not hinder them, for the kingdom of heaven belongs to such as these” (Matthew 19:14). Sunday school became a place of joy and divine encounter, where teachers imparted biblical stories and led us in Christian songs. Our progress was assessed by reciting prayers and creeds, motivating us to learn and grow in our faith.

A Bond of Fellowship:

As we progressed through Holy Communion and Confirmation classes, my friends and I formed a close-knit community, sharing a Christ-centered relationship. Our catechetical instructors not only taught church doctrine and sacramental importance but also emphasized character building, tolerance, kindness, and discipleship. We understood the significance of a holistic Christian education that shaped our spiritual and moral lives.

The Challenge of Secularism and Relativism:

In today’s society, Christian educational institutions have faced challenges influenced by culture, government, finance, and social policies. The rise of secularism and relativism has posed threats to the church’s influence and the nurturing of Christian education. However, it is essential to acknowledge these challenges and address them to safeguard the spiritual growth of future generations.

The Church’s Role in Spiritual Education:

The church holds the responsibility to prioritize spiritual education for children. It should not only supplement parental discipleship but also equip parents to effectively disciple their own children. Collaboration between the church and parents is crucial, ensuring that children receive consistent spiritual guidance and nurturing. The church should teach and promote the gospel to children, similar to its approach with adult congregants, fostering a faith that withstands the challenges of secularism and relativism.

Training and Equipping Teachers:

To enhance the teaching ministry within the church, it is essential to invest in the training of volunteer workers. Regular training sessions should be conducted to equip Christian education teachers with the necessary tools and knowledge. Understanding the developmental characteristics of preschoolers, children, youth, and adults is vital for effective Christian education. By empowering teachers with the skills and insights needed, the church can effectively impact the spiritual growth of its members.

The Impact of Christian Education:

Christian education serves as a powerful tool for spreading the gospel, meeting community needs, and guiding children along the right path (Proverbs 22:6). It fulfills the call to discipleship and provides a safe haven for those facing struggles. Scripture emphasizes the importance of caring for the depressed, making Christian education a place of comfort and healing.

Conclusion:

As we evaluate the church’s role in Christian education, let us recognize its importance in shaping future generations. By prioritizing spiritual education, partnering with parents, and equipping teachers, the church can effectively nurture faith, resilience, and a solid foundation in the lives of its members. Let us strive to create an environment where Christian education flourishes, impacting individuals and communities with the transforming power of the gospel.

ABOUT BIBLE UNIVERSITY

Bible University is a private, non-profit, and distance learning educational institution, Christian Seminary whose mission is to educate anyone who feels called to study the Bible and Christian faith completely free of charge. We offer Tuition-Free University programs for anyone who wishes to learn about the Bible, Christianity, Religion, Apologetics, Gnosticism, or prepare for the Ministry. All course material is completely online with no fees for textbooks. The students reside in over 150 countries around the world with the faculty also teaching from all parts of the world. Bible University grants Bachelor Degrees to PhD Degrees.
